The Bosch Rexroth Indramat VT-VSPA1-1-1X-SO43A-1729 is part of the VT-VSPA Proportional Amplifiers series and weighs 0.1 kg. This amplifier has card dimensions of 100 by 160 mm and uses a 32-pole DIN 41612 D connector. It operates with a nominal supply voltage of 24 VDC and has a maximum power consumption of 50 VA.

Product Description:

The VT-VSPA1-1-1X-SO43A-1729 is a plug-in proportional amplifier board from Bosch Rexroth Indramat in the VT-VSPA Proportional Amplifiers series. Mounted in a Eurocard rack, the module links a motion controller to a hydraulic proportional valve. It converts low-power command voltages into regulated solenoid currents, enabling precise pressure or flow modulation in presses, molding machines, and handling equipment. Integrated signal conditioning and current control reduce cabinet wiring and quicken closed-loop responses.

Mechanically, the card follows the Eurocard footprint of 100 × 160 mm, so it slips into standard backplane frames without adapters. All electrical lines terminate on a 32-pole DIN 41612 D plug that provides keyed, vibration-resistant mating. Supply power passes through a 2.5 A Time-Lag fuse that absorbs brief inrush events yet protects against sustained overloads. Command Input 1 reaches full scale at 9 V; Input 2 extends to 10 V, letting the board accept either low-range or higher PLC reference levels. Differential input resistance never drops below 100 kΩ, so the source device is not loaded, and a ±9 VDC reference rail is present for external potentiometers.

The amplifier is designed for a nominal supply of 24 VDC and remains functional down to the 22 V lower limit and up to the 35 V upper limit, giving tolerance for line sag or generator ripple. Under maximum load, the electronics draw 1.8 A, translating to a peak power demand of 50 VA on the system power supply, so heat dissipation in the cabinet is moderate. A 50 mA ready transistor output signals to upstream controllers when the internal voltages are within range. Current monitoring inputs exhibit 100 Ω resistance, helping maintain stable feedback signals. Even with its steel front plate measuring 128.4 mm in height, the board weighs only 0.1 kg.
